Who won female snowboarding?

Chloe Kim
Chloe Kim has made Olympic history at the 2022 Beijing Olympics as the first woman to win two golds in the snowboard halfpipe. This comes after she became the youngest woman to win an Olympic snowboarding gold medal in 2018, when she placed first in the women’s snowboard halfpipe at just 17 years old.

    What is a 1260 in snowboarding?

    But one move has become synonymous with the American superstar: the Double McTwist 1260. The move combines three-and-a-half twists and two flips in one piece of air all with a snowboard strapped to his feet, and he first competed it at the Olympic Winter Games during his victory lap at Vancouver 2010.

    Why are snowboarders short?

    Generally speaking at one end of the spectrum freestyle snowboards are supposed to be shorter to help with spin speed and technical control, and big-mountain powder boards are designed to be longer to aid with stability at speed and floatation over deeper snow.

    Who inspired Chloe Kim to snowboard?

    Chloe Kim began snowboarding when she was just four years old, per People. The sport came naturally to Kim, and her father, Jong Jin, started taking her on six-hour drives from their Torrance, California, home to Mammoth Mountain Ski Area to practice.
